Israel “Izzy” Englander is the founder of Millennium Management, one of the world’s largest multi-strategy hedge fund platforms. Millennium allocates capital across hundreds of independent teams rather than a single house view, with rigorous risk controls at the platform level. Englander’s model has been highly influential in the rise of pod-shop multi-manager structures across the industry.

Israel Englander's Q3 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2019, Israel Englander held 4,833 positions worth $63.3B, down 4.9% from $66.5B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 7.2% of the portfolio.

Israel Englander withdrew a net $4.18B in Q3 2019, closing 727 positions and reducing 1,651 holdings. Its most notable exit was Worldpay, Inc., an estimated $429M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Miscellaneous at 28% of assets, up from 22%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.

Against the trend, Israel Englander opened a new position in L3Harris worth $288M.

  • Israel Englander's largest Q3 2019 buy was L3Harris: 1,378,220 shares worth $288M.
  • Israel Englander added most to Ameren in Q3 2019, an estimated $239M increase.
  • Israel Englander's biggest Q3 2019 reduction was LyondellBasell Industries, cutting an estimated $441M.
  • Israel Englander fully exited Worldpay, Inc. in Q3 2019, selling an estimated $429M.
  • Israel Englander's ten largest holdings make up 7.2% of its $63.3B portfolio in Q3 2019.
  • Israel Englander opened 843 new positions and closed 727 in Q3 2019.
  • Israel Englander's portfolio value fell 4.9% quarter-over-quarter to $63.3B.

Based on Millennium Management's 13F filing for Q3 2019, filed 14 Nov 2019.
